
Descripción general
Delphi2Cpp Professional es una robusta utilidad de migración y conversión diseñada para ayudar a desarrolladores a trasladar bases de código heredadas de Delphi a proyectos modernos en C++. Esta página explica cómo la herramienta ayuda a los equipos a acelerar la modernización, preservar la lógica de la aplicación y reducir reescrituras manuales. El contenido a continuación describe el enfoque principal, la funcionalidad, las ventajas y los escenarios típicos donde el producto es eficaz.
Sobre la herramienta
Delphi2Cpp Professional se centra en traducir estructuras de código fuente, tipos y comportamientos en tiempo de ejecución de Delphi a equivalentes C++ mantenibles. Soporta una amplia gama de constructos del lenguaje y ofrece opciones para ajustar la salida para que coincida con los estándares de codificación y las necesidades del proyecto. La herramienta se integra con entornos de desarrollo comunes y soporta procesamiento por lotes para bases de código de gran tamaño.
Cómo funciona
El proceso de conversión combina análisis estático, mapeo de patrones y reglas de transformación configurables. Primero, se escanea el código para construir una representación abstracta de módulos, clases y unidades. A continuación, los patrones de lenguaje se emparejan y transforman en constructos C++. El sistema también genera código wrapper para bibliotecas en tiempo de ejecución y ofrece puntos de intervención manual cuando la semántica requiere atención cuidadosa. A lo largo del proceso, registros detallados e informes de mapeo ayudan a los ingenieros a revisar los cambios y validar los resultados.
- Es el instalador, no el software en sí – más pequeño, más rápido y práctico
- Instalación con un clic – sin configuración manual
- El instalador descarga el Delphi2Cpp Professional 2026 completo.
Cómo instalar
- Descarga y extrae el archivo ZIP
- Abre la carpeta extraída y ejecuta el archivo de instalación
- Cuando Windows muestre una ventana azul de “aplicación no reconocida”:
- Haz clic en Más información → Ejecutar de todas formas
- Haz clic en Sí en el aviso de Control de cuentas de usuario
- Espera la instalación automática (~1 minuto)
- Haz clic en Iniciar descarga
- Una vez finalizada la descarga, ejecútalo desde el acceso directo del escritorio
- Disfruta
Características clave
- Traducción precisa de constructos del lenguaje Delphi a equivalentes C++, incluyendo clases, interfaces y genéricos
- Mapeo automatizado de funciones comunes de bibliotecas en tiempo de ejecución a bibliotecas y utilidades C++ compatibles
- Reglas de transformación personalizables que permiten a los equipos aplicar estándares de codificación y convenciones de nombres
- Procesamiento por lotes para manejar proyectos grandes y múltiples unidades en una sola ejecución
- Plugins de integración para IDEs y sistemas de compilación populares para optimizar el flujo de trabajo
- Informes completos y herramientas de diff para seguir cambios y verificar la fidelidad de la conversión
- Soporte para conversión incremental, permitiendo proyectos híbridos que mezclen módulos traducidos y originales
Ventajas
Adoptar Delphi2Cpp Professional puede reducir significativamente el tiempo y el esfuerzo necesarios para mover aplicaciones heredadas a una base de código C++ moderna. Al automatizar tareas repetitivas de traducción, la herramienta minimiza errores humanos y preserva la lógica original de la aplicación. Los equipos se benefician de una mejor mantenibilidad, mayor compatibilidad con cadenas de herramientas y mejor acceso a bibliotecas y frameworks modernos. Además, los informes de transformación ayudan a los desarrolladores a comprender los cambios y acelerar los ciclos de revisión de código. Para organizaciones que planifican mantenimiento a largo plazo o mejoras de rendimiento, la herramienta ofrece una ruta pragmática hacia la modernización al reducir el riesgo del proyecto.
Escenarios comunes
- Grandes aplicaciones heredadas en Delphi que necesitan migración a C++ para mantenimiento a largo plazo
- Módulos sensibles al rendimiento que se benefician de la optimización en C++ y compilación nativa
- Equipos que estandarizan en una única pila de lenguajes y requieren traducción automatizada de unidades antiguas
- Proyectos que deben integrar lógica Delphi en una base de código C++ moderna sin una reescritura completa
- Migración incremental donde módulos seleccionados se convierten y validan antes de la transición total
Observaciones finales
Delphi2Cpp Professional ofrece un enfoque práctico y eficiente para organizaciones que enfrentan retos de modernización de sistemas heredados. Con funciones de conversión focalizadas, reglas personalizables y opciones de integración, la herramienta ayuda a preservar el comportamiento de la aplicación mientras permite la migración a un ecosistema moderno. Ya sea que el objetivo sea mejorar el rendimiento, consolidar cadenas de herramientas o extender la vida útil de software crítico, esta solución ofrece un camino estructurado que reduce el trabajo manual y soporta la validación en cada etapa.